On Helmholtz equations and counterexamples to Strichartz estimates in hyperbolic space (1902.04351v1)
Abstract: In this paper, we study nonlinear Helmholtz equations (NLH) $-\Delta_{\mathbb{H}N} u - \frac{(N-1)2}{4} u -\lambda2 u = \Gamma|u|{p-2}u$ in $\mathbb{H}N$, $N\geq 2$ where $\Delta_{\mathbb{H}N}$ denotes the Laplace-Beltrami operator in the hyperbolic space $\mathbb{H}N$ and $\Gamma\in L\infty(\mathbb{H}N)$ is chosen suitably. Using fixed point and variational techniques, we find nontrivial solutions to (NLH) for all $\lambda>0$ and $p>2$. The oscillatory behaviour and decay rates of radial solutions is analyzed, with possible extensions to Cartan-Hadamard manifolds and Damek-Ricci spaces. Our results rely on a new Limiting Absorption Principle for the Helmholtz operator in $\mathbb{H}N$. As a byproduct, we obtain simple counterexamples to certain Strichartz estimates.
